"Schipbreuk van de Overhout, 1777" is an etching by Reinier Vinkeles depicting the shipwreck of the Dutch merchant ship "Overhout" in 1777. The artwork, housed in the Rijksmuseum, showcases Vinkeles' skill in capturing the dramatic scene of the ship caught in a raging storm with its masts broken and waves crashing around it. The etching, executed in a detailed and realistic style, serves as a historical record of a maritime disaster and a testament to the power of nature.
